Biography

Dmitri joined University of Glasgow in 2017, serving as a Senior Lecturer in Corporate Finance and Banking before becoming Professor of Finance. Prior to this, he worked at Essex Business School, University of Essex, UK, University of Heidelberg, Germany, and the Higher School of Economics in Moscow, Russia. His research focuses on the microeconomic foundations of finance, exploring applications of microeconomics to uncertainty in financial markets, banking, public finance, and the macroeconomic implications of finance. Dmitri investigates the role that financial systems play in economic growth and their effects on inequality and well-being. He is involved in various funded projects by the EU, UN, British Academy, Bank of England, and the Russian Foundation for Fundamental Research. His research interests include financial intermediation during financial crises and the impact of individual decisions under uncertainty on financial markets and well-being. Dmitri is also actively supervising doctoral research in areas such as Banking, Corporate Finance, and Behavioral Finance. Additionally, he teaches courses on Financial Markets and Financial Risk Management at both undergraduate and postgraduate levels, and serves on the editorial board of the Journal of Industrial Business Economics.
